This procurement opportunity is for the California Air National Guard at March Air Reserve Base, seeking a firm-fixed-price contract for emergency generator repair and replacement: - Government Buyer: - United States Property and Fiscal Office (USPFO) for California, 163 MSC, March Air Reserve Base - California Air National Guard, Bldg 2271 - OEMs and Vendors: - Generac (primary OEM for generator and accessories) - Products/Services Requested: - Generac Industrial Diesel engine-driven generator set (500 kW, 277/480 VAC, three phase, 60 Hz) - Includes Level 1 Acoustic Steel Enclosure, 1001-gallon double-wall UL142 basetank, H-100 Control Panel, Permanent Magnet Excitation, UL2200, EPA Certified, SCAQMD compliant - Accessories: battery charger, batteries, coolant heater, crankcase oil heater, engine run relay, 12 Position Load Center, 21 Light Annunciator - Standard 2-Year Limited Warranty - PSTS Series Automatic Transfer Switch (800 Amp, 3 Pole, 277/480 VAC, NEMA 3R Enclosure, ATC-300+ Microprocessor-Based Controller) - Startup Service for generator set (performed by factory-trained technicians) - Emergency repair and precision restoration of inoperable alternator on Generac 500kW generator (all labor, materials, tools, equipment, specialized rigging, transportation, and testing apparatus) - Unique/Notable Requirements: - Specialized rigging and testing apparatus required for alternator repair - Factory-trained technicians for generator startup - Warranty options up to 10 years - Set aside for Service Disabled Veteran Owned Small Businesses (SDVOSB) - NAICS code 811310 (Commercial and Industrial Machinery and Equipment Repair and Maintenance) - SCAQMD compliance and EPA certification for generator - Freight to first destination included - Remote emergency stop switch and MODBUS communication for transfer switch - Onsite startup services scheduled during business hours (fuel not included)
Description
The USPFO for CA intends to award a single firm-fixed-price contract for services to provide all labor, transportation, materials, tools, equipment, appliances, and supervision necessary Repair Generac 500kW Generator at 163rd Attack Wing, March ARB Ca:
The scope of service encompasses all management, labor, tools, equipment, specialized rigging, materials, parts, transportation, and testing apparatus necessary to perform the emergency replacement and precision restoration of an inoperable alternator on the 500 kW emergency backup diesel generator.
THIS REQUIREMENT IS BEING SOLICITED 100% SERVICE DISABLED VETERAN OWNED SMALL BUSINESS SET-ASIDE. THE NAICS CODE FOR THIS ACQUISITION IS 811310 AND THE SMALL BUSINESS SIZE STANDARD IS $12,500,000.00.
